I use a company service truck it's an 06 F450 with the dreaded 6.0.
The right side CAC hose next to the battery keeps popping off under load, I put new hoses and clamps on it, but it still pops off.
I removed the hoses and pipe from the truck, found on YouTube the clamp that goes on the lower end of the pipe with the detent in the grove of the pipe with the clamp over it, should the clamp be torqued about 110 inlbs, is that right or am I missing something? Thanks.

Maks sure all oil is removed from boot and intercooler barb, spray the inside of boot with hair spray. After installation let it dry for a while, this should stop it.

I'm curious as to what the purpose of the hair spray is for, is it to make it tacky, like an adhesive? I read something about using hair spray.

Yes it gets tacky and it doesn't set up so hard that it won't come back apart later. It is also easy to clean up when it needs to be taken apart later on.

I was skeptical that it would work when I first heard about it, have used it with success numerous times. The aerosol seems to work the best.
